What are solutions containing ions that react with acids or bases to minimize their effects?

Buffers are solutions that contain a weak acid and its a conjugate base; as such, they can absorb excess H+ ions or OH– ions, thereby maintaining an overall steady pH in the solution.

What changes color in the presence of an acid or a base?

chemical indicator, any substance that gives a visible sign, usually by a colour change, of the presence or absence of a threshold concentration of a chemical species, such as an acid or an alkali in a solution. An example is the substance called methyl yellow, which imparts a yellow colour to an alkaline solution.

What does the color change in titration mean?

The indicator changes to pink because the phenolphthalein is ionized in basic solution. The base strips H+ ions from the acid, and near the end of the titration, it starts pulling H+ ions from the phenolphthalein. Phenolphthalein is a unique molecule. When the H+ is stripped off, it changes color from clear to pink.

What causes universal indicator solution to change from green to red?

Acids cause universal indicator solution to change from green toward red. Bases cause universal indicator to change from green toward purple. Water molecules (H 2O) can interact with one another to form H 3O + ions and OH − ions. At a pH of 7, there are equal numbers of H 3O + ions and OH − ions in water, and this is called a neutral solution.
